Verse 15
Genesis 37:15
Young's Literal Translation
15
And a man findeth him, and lo, he is wandering in the field, and the man asketh him, saying, 'What seekest thou?'
Original Language Text
hebrew
וַ/יִּמְצָאֵ֣/הוּ אִ֔ישׁ וְ/הִנֵּ֥ה תֹעֶ֖ה בַּ/שָּׂדֶ֑ה וַ/יִּשְׁאָלֵ֧/הוּ הָ/אִ֛ישׁ לֵ/אמֹ֖ר מַה תְּבַקֵּֽשׁ
English Translation
And he found a man, and behold, he was wandering in the field, and the man asked him, saying, "What are you seeking?"
